La commande tpm ne prend pas en charge la solution PHP : 1. Utilisez la bibliothèque de développement et l'API TPM, vous pouvez utiliser d'autres langages de programmation qui prennent en charge M pour écrire du code, puis appeler ces codes via le mécanisme d'appel externe de PHP ; bibliothèques ou extensions tierces, vous pouvez utiliser la fonction TPM en introduisant ces bibliothèques ; 3. À l'aide des outils de ligne de commande, vous pouvez exécuter les outils de ligne de commande correspondants via la fonction exec() de PHP ou la fonction shell_exec() ; Interface de service Web, en envoyant une requête HTTP pour appeler la fonction TPM.
L'environnement d'exploitation de cet article : système Windows 10, PHP version 8.1.3, ordinateur Dell G3.
Si la commande TPM (Trusted Platform Module) ne prend pas en charge PHP, vous pouvez envisager les solutions suivantes :
1 Utiliser les bibliothèques et les API de développement TPM : TPM dispose généralement de bibliothèques de développement et d'API qui peuvent être utilisées pour communiquer avec. TPM via ces interfaces pour interagir. Le code peut être écrit dans d'autres langages de programmation prenant en charge M (tels que C++, C#, etc.), puis appelé via le mécanisme d'appel externe de PHP (tel que la fonction exec() ou la fonction shell_exec()). Cela permet la communication avec le TPM en appelant le code sous-jacent au milieu de PHP.
2. Utilisez des bibliothèques ou des extensions tierces : Certains développeurs peuvent avoir développé des extensions ou des bibliothèques PHP pour TPM, et vous pouvez utiliser les fonctions TPM en introduisant ces bibliothèques. Vous pouvez trouver ces bibliothèques en effectuant une recherche dans la communauté open source ou en utilisant un moteur de recherche.
3. Utilisez les outils de ligne de commande : Si TPM fournit des outils de ligne de commande, vous pouvez exécuter les outils de ligne de commande correspondants via la fonction exec() de PHP ou la fonction shell_exec(). De cette manière, l'outil de ligne de commande peut être appelé dans le script PHP pour faire fonctionner le TPM.
4. Utilisez l'interface de service Web de TPM : Si TPM fournit une interface de service Web, vous pouvez communiquer avec TPM via la bibliothèque curl de PHP ou d'autres bibliothèques de requêtes HTTP. La fonctionnalité du TPM peut être invoquée en envoyant une requête HTTP.
Il convient de noter que lorsque vous utilisez des appels externes, des outils de ligne de commande ou des interfaces de services Web, vous devez vous assurer que la communication avec le TPM est sécurisée et suivre les exigences de sécurité et les meilleures pratiques du TPM.
Résumé
Bien que la commande TPM elle-même ne prenne pas directement en charge PHP, elle peut interagir avec TPM en appelant le code sous-jacent, en utilisant des bibliothèques ou des extensions tierces, en appelant des outils de ligne de commande ou en utilisant l'interface de service Web de TPM. Cela permet d'implémenter les fonctions liées au TPM en PHP.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!